The minimum operating preload is analyzed and given for fixed-position preload paired angular contact ball bearings used under high-speed and high-temperature based on Hertz contact theory,which is able to effectively prevent gyro rotation of bails.The relationship between initial preload and minimum operating preload is built with the influences of high-temperature,centrifugal inflation in high speed operation,operating temperature and magnitude of interference fit on bearing preload.The calculation software is programmed based on this relationship,and the required initial preload is quickly received.%基于Hertz接触理论,分析并给出了高温、高速下定位预紧配对角接触球轴承的最小工作预紧力,以有效防止球的陀螺旋转,结合高温、高速工作中离心膨胀、工作温度及配合过盈量对轴承预紧力的影响,建立了初始预紧力及最小工作预紧力的关系,基于此关系编制计算软件,可以快速得到所需初始预紧力.
